“Plus he wrote Eight Is Enough which became a TV series.”

That always surprised me the most about Tom Braden’s bio. Braden the curmudgeon liberal ex-spook being the inspiration for a tv sitcom.

Crossfire with Buchanan and Braden was a good show. They managed to debate real issues and it wasn’t a clown show, unlike the majority of their imitators over the years.

Maybe that was because Buchanan and Braden both had been journalists before going on TV, and they were disciplined in the art of constructing arguments and presenting ideas. “Discipline” isn’t something I associate with, say, Sean Hannity.
